The process of acquiring a driving license in Portugal is broken down into several key steps. Below is an in-depth guideline to help potential drivers navigate each phase:
Step 1: Prepare for Your Theory ExamEligibility: You must be at least 18 years old for a Category B license. For Categories A and C, the minimum age varies.Study Materials: Enroll in a driving school to access study products, including handbooks and practice tests.Test Format: The theory examination includes multiple-choice concerns covering traffic laws, signs, and safe driving practices.Step 2: Enroll in a Driving School
Necessary training is needed for all brand-new chauffeurs. Enrolling in an accredited driving school will offer:
Practical Lessons: Hands-on driving experience under the guidance of a licensed trainer.Mock Exams: Simulated tests to get ready for both the theory and useful exams.Action 3: Pass the Theory Exam
To advance to practical screening, candidates must successfully pass the theory exam. The exam normally entails:
Questions: Approximately 30 questions related to traffic laws and safe driving.Passing Score: A minimum rating of 28 out of 30 is needed to pass.Step 4: Complete Practical Driving Lessons
As soon as the theory test is passed, prospects will proceed to useful driving lessons. Secret aspects consist of:
Number of Lessons: Usually, a minimum of 20 useful lessons is suggested.Driving Skills: Focus on essential driving maneuvers, parking, and road awareness.Step 5: Take the Practical Driving Exam
The practical test evaluates driving ability in real-world conditions. Here are some essential information:
Duration: The examination normally lasts around 40 minutes.Examination Criteria: Safety, adherence to traffic laws, maneuvering abilities, and general lorry control are evaluated.Step 6: Obtain Your License
After passing both exams, you can obtain your driving license at the Institute for Mobility and Transport (IMT):
Required Documents:
Identity file (passport or residence card)Proof of medical physical fitness (a medical examination certificate)Theory and practical exam certificatesPayment for licensing fees
Issuance: The license is usually provided within a couple of weeks.

A1: Yes, you can use your foreign driving license for a minimal duration, typically as much as 185 days after your arrival in Portugal. After this duration, you must transform your license to a Portuguese one.
Q2: What are the medical requirements to get a driving license?
A2: A medical checkup is needed to ensure fitness to drive, consisting of vision tests and look for health conditions that might impact driving capability.
Q3: How much does it cost to acquire a driving license in Portugal?
A3: The overall expense can vary based on the driving school, but normally, it ranges between EUR600 to EUR1,200, consisting of exam charges and lessons.
Q4: What if I fail the driving exam?
A4: Candidates can retake the useful test after a waiting period, normally a few weeks. Additional lessons are suggested to prepare for the next attempt.
Q5: Is it possible to accelerate the process?
A5: While all actions are needed, some driving schools provide intensive courses which can reduce the time it takes to prepare for and take the examinations.
